It appears that you have a triangle where angle \( O \) is \( 19^\circ \), angle \( P \) is a right angle (\( 90^\circ \)), and side \( PQ \) (opposite angle \( O \)) has a length of \( 33 \).

To find the length of side \( x \) (which we'll assume is side \( OP \), adjacent to angle \( O \)), you can use basic trigonometric functions. Since you have an angle and need to find the length of the adjacent side, you can use the tangent function:

\[
\tan(O) = \frac{\text{opposite}}{\text{adjacent}}
\]

In this case:

\[
\tan(19^\circ) = \frac{33}{x}
\]

To solve for \( x \):

1. Rearrange the equation:
\[
x = \frac{33}{\tan(19^\circ)}
\]

2. Calculate \( \tan(19^\circ) \) (you can use a calculator):
\[
\tan(19^\circ) \approx 0.3443
\]

3. Substitute the value back into the equation:
\[
x = \frac{33}{0.3443} \approx 95.9
\]

So, the length of side \( OP \) is approximately \( 95.9 \) units when rounded to the nearest tenth.
